The Death of Smail-aga Čengić is an epic poem in five cantos, written in 1846, based on a real historical event – the murder of the infamous Ottoman military leader Smail-aga Čengić.
From the Days of Youth (1883) by Franjo Marković is a collection of lyrical poems from the youth of this prominent Croatian intellectual, including original patriotic and intimate poems and translations by foreign authors.
Zlobec's Anthology of Slovenian Poetry traces the development of Slovenian lyric poetry from Vodnik and Prešeren to the poets of the 1970s, through key poetics and generations, on more than 300 pages.
